. all he said he can do is that if the parts and labour charge was less than 595 then that`ll be the price.... But who knows if its gonna be more than that!? Joolz have you got a nice quote for me?? xx??Slave cylinder at a TVR dealer was
50 quid for parts (seals only) plus 350 give or take for labour inc VAT.
I usually go to Indys' for work but this was an emergency.
It's a big job as the gearbox and bellhousing have to come off to access the slave cylinder. Takes about 6 hours IIRC.
Cylinder itself is around 200-250 quid depending on who you get it from by the sound of things.
If the 600 quid figure is with a new cylinder then it's probably not too far off the mark.
The 400 odd for a master is an absolute shocker
If they say they have changed the cylinder then I would be wanting to see the old one to confirm.
